Set The Date: Streamlined Simplicity

Set The Date is designed with modern users in mind — fast, frictionless, and built for group chats.

Highlights:

  • Minimal interface focused on user action
  • Real-time notifications when someone votes
  • Custom notes and multi-date options for better context
  • Works beautifully in mobile browsers and WhatsApp

Set The Date eliminates login requirements and makes casual planning smoother than traditional tools.


WhenAvailable: Feature-Packed Powerhouse

WhenAvailable leans into advanced scheduling needs.

Key Strengths:

  • Recurring meeting support
  • Cross-timezone coordination
  • Robust integrations and calendar sync
  • Custom SMS/email alerts

It suits users who need a more corporate-style experience or manage complex meeting flows.

Real-Time Updates and Notifications

Set The Date shines when speed matters. Once someone votes or a date is locked in, notifications go out instantly. For quick planning (like dinner this Friday), it’s perfect. WhenAvailable’s notifications are customizable, but more complex to set up.


Cross-Platform Support and Integration

Both tools work on desktop and mobile, but Set The Date is optimized for tap-first use (think WhatsApp or mobile Safari). WhenAvailable offers better integration across enterprise platforms, making it more suitable for team leads and remote staff.
